How to become Sakka, King of Heaven? [9] 

Mahali, 10 , a Lichavi king in the capital of Vesali, one day, hears the Buddha, praising the glory of the King of Darkness Sa Sakka, asked:
 Buddha, he knew or had never met the King of heaven Dao-profit is Sakka not?
 Mahali, of course Tathagata meet and know about Sakka.
- By  virtue of virtue and good deeds that Sakka is king of heaven Dao-Loi?
 Mahali, before reborn as king of Dao-Loi, Sakka is the Magha prince of Magadha, nicknamed Maghava. Prince Magha often practiced pure danam adasi and was nicknamed Purindada. Magha also frequently gives sakkaccham to the monks who are nicknamed Sakka. Magha also offered a place to live (avasatham), nicknamed Vasava. Magha is very intelligent and can think of a thousand things (sahassam attham) at the same time should be nicknamed Sahassakkha. Sakka has his wife Asura (Sujata), nicknamed Sujampati. Sakka leads the gods of the Tavatimsa to the so-called Indra or Thich Nhu Nhon. Prince Magha thanks to complete his seven vows so after the reincarnation is reborn as Sakka, king of heaven Tavatimsa. The seven vows are :
1.   Throughout this life, I vow to nourish my parents in full.
2.   During this life, I venerate all the elders.
3.   Throughout this life, I vow to speak with gentleness all the time.
4.   Throughout this life, I vow never to speak ill of anyone.
5.   Throughout this life, I wish to live a layman's life with a generous, generous, supportive heart.
6.   Throughout this life, I vow to always speak honest words.
7.   Throughout this life, I vow never to be angry. If my heart aches to rise, I will quickly extinguish it.
Mahali, thanks to the completion of the seven vows that Prince Magha was reborn as Sakka, king of heaven Tavatimsa.

Capture the leaves of simsapa and monks Malunkyaputta [20] 

During the ninth season, great disciples such as Mahakassapa, Moggallana, Sariputta were absent from the Buddha seat because they had to preside over the other retreat centers. Rahula must study with Sariputta. Adjacent to the Buddha is the attendant Nagita and teacher Ananda.
Ghosita condominium is located in the simsapa forest. One afternoon from the forest, the Buddha holding a handful of simsapa leaves. He picked up the leaf and asked the monks who were present:
 Teachers, leaves in the Tathagata hand or leaves in the forest much?
 Praise the Buddha, the number of leaves in the hands of the Buddha is very little, but the leaves in the forest are countless countless.
 Yes, the teachers, knowledge of Tathagata as much as the number of leaves in the forest, but the Tathagata teaches you just like the number of leaves in the fist. Why so? Because Tathagata just wants to present to you what really is useful for the practice to achieve enlightenment and liberation only. Once completely enlightened then of course you have full knowledge of a Buddha without learning. But now you should put all your mind into the practice of meditation that has the benefit of enlightenment and liberation, not to worry and to waste time in futile discussions.
The reason why the Buddha has such advice is because a few days ago Mr. Malunkyaputta and some other mendicants, after a heated debate with each other, dragged together to ask the Buddha:
 Lord, is this universe boundary or boundless? Limited or infinite?
The Buddha silent silence. Malunkyaputta could not bear the Buddha's silence, continued:
 If the Blessed One answered my questions, I would continue to study with him for the rest of my life." If not, I would give up the almsgiving congregation. If you really know the universe is endowed or infinite, then please say so. And if you do not know, do not tell him straight away.
The Buddha looked at the teacher Malunkyaputta freely said:
 Malunkyaputta, the teacher asked to leave home, Tathagata has promised him to explain to you about such questions? Tathagata says, "Malunkyaputta, you leave home, will Tathagata teach you about metaphysical matters?"
 Lord, do not.
 So why now you set conditions with Tathagata?
Malunkyaputta, as if one was hit by a poisoned arrow. The relatives invited a physician to extract the arrow and bandage and give the pesticide. But the person who was hit by the name did not let the doctor touch his wound. He said, "Wait, before healing the wound, I want to know who shot the arrow, what is the name of the person, what age, where, what type of work, what class, for what purpose shoot I also want to know what the wood is made of, and how the poison is processed. "Malunkyaputta, the wounded man will die before he finds out all that. (Trung A-ji: Kinh Diễu)
So is the monk. Things that the monk must know and must practice are the basic things that Tathagata has been teaching teachers. As for other things, because there is no practical benefit to the practice and practice to go to enlightenment and liberation, so Tathagata not talk about.
Listen to this, Malunkyaputta sincerely ask for repentance, then bow out.

Anuruddha Anupdha meets Buddha at Dong-Truc Park [25] 

At the gate of Dongguan Park in Karagama City, the Buddha was stopped by the gardener. He said:
 Do not go to the park, do not disturb the teacher meditating in it.
The Buddha did not know how to say the great virtue Anuruddha from the park came out. Seeing the Buddha, great virtue greeted salute, then said to the gardener:
 This is our teacher, please let him in.
Great Buddha brought the Buddha into the park to meet the virtues of Nandiya and Kimbila.Nandiya lifted the bowl, and Kimbila lifted the garment to the Buddha. They invited the Buddha to sit next to a yellow bamboo, bring water and towels to wash his face and wash his feet. Then the three hands to pay respect Buddha. Buddha asked:
 Are the teachers here safe? Is the training convenient? Is begging and propagation easy?
 The Blessed One," replied Anuruddha, "we are safe here, the scenery is calm, the begging and the propagation is no obstacle. Thanks to the favorable context, we have made much progress in our study.
 Do the teachers love each other and get along?
 Dear Brother, we love each other. We harmonize with each other as easily as water with milk.Whenever something important happens we come together to make a common decision. While learning Dhamma, if there is anything suspicious or unclear, we discuss together to learn and exchange experience with each other. Dear Lord, thanks to the three people in common, we can see that our study is easier and more convenient.
 Very well, the Buddha said, living in harmony with each other is the most favorable conditions for the study.
The Buddha stayed in Dong Truc Park for a month to observe the way of living and study of the three teachers, while teaching more teachings and practice. Before leaving the great virtues of Anuruddha, Nandiya and Kimbila, the Buddha said:
 Teacher, if all the mendicants in the congregation can treat each other as teachers, it is very beneficial and easy for the common practice. From now Tathagata proposed application allows  Luc Hoa  below for mendicant in general:
1.  Firstly  relatives residing sociable , peace means the sharing together a retreat center, a forest or a roof.
2-  The second is  the harmony of the army , that is to share the same food and amenities in life.
3.  Third  World religious harmony , together means respecting the common law world.
4-  The fourth is  the invisible , that is, to speak with each other using gentle words, do not use the words cause friction and controversy.
5-  The fifth is  the mediation of mutual understanding , that is to learn together and exchange knowledge in peace, not be concealed or debated.
6-  Friday is  the desire to co-approve , that is, when different opinions, must review together so that people harmonious and sympathetic with each other.
Teachers, from now on, all the monks in the congregation must take these six principles of harmony that treat one another.
